Levels of Communication - ANSWER Casual Communication - low intensity, inconsequential, and light (ex: a spontaneous chat with a coworker in the hallway) 29. Critical Communication - slightly higher intensity, more consequential, qnd a little more challenging (ex: a phone call to discuss the status of a project with its owner) 30. The communication Cycle - ANSWER SENDER (message, endcode) --&gt; SEND --&gt; RECEIVER (decode, interpret) --&gt; receiver becomes sender Sender fliters message through unique lens of emotion, experience, background, education, and more. As the receiver, your job is to decode the messages coming your way, unpack them, and create meaning from them. When you are ready to provide feedback, you become the sender. 31. Being an Effective Communicator - ANSWER As the sender, this means your message is clear; you make the decoding process easy for the receiver(s) and minimize the potential for misunderstanding. As the receiver, this means you decode messages wisely, ensuring the understanding of the meaning of others. 32. Types of Communication - ANSWER One-Way - Message from sender to receiver, a fast effective way to disseminate information, but can create challenges; receivers do not have an opportunity to clarify 33. Two-Way - messages are sent and received back and forth between two or more parties, creating a mutual exchange (ex: group discussion) 34. Why Communication Matters - ANSWER Your communication skills influence how people perceive you, how they treat you, and ultimately, the opportunities they afford now and in the future. Communication is the foundation for building, maintaining, and leveraging relationships; helps establish powerful, collaborative, and synergistic relationships. 35. Effective Communicators - ANSWER Avoid using: - Indirect, unclear, or vague words - Exaggerations - Buzzwords, jargon, obscure acronyms, and overly technical or complicated language - Too many words - Inappropriate or foul language 36. Tone of Voice - ANSWER Pitch - the degree of height or depth of a sound Pace - the rate at which words are spoken Volume - the degree of sound intensity or loudness Inflection - the rhythmic up anf down of the voice, which shapes words Emphasis - the stress places upon a specific word or words to underscore importance 37. 3 Reasons for Disorganization - ANSWER 1. You have too much stuff (Declutter) 2. The things you have do not have a place where they belong (Pick a Place) 3. You don't put things back where they belong (Put Things Back) 38. Paper Filing - ANSWER Purpose based, not type based Employee file is purpose based. Type based is too broad. Start broad and narrow down Consider location Understand retention policies 39. Digital Filing - ANSWER Logical hierarchical structure Consistent naming convention Regular & frequent clean up routine 40.
